Code Name: Weak Shellshield
Secret Identity: Local Biker Gang Members
Type: Grunt
Life: 200 HP
Attacks: Punch - 40-48 damage
Shell Slam - Damage skill, damage range unknown. High chance of inflicting Stun
Counter Rate: 20%
Dodge Rate: 0%
Threat Level: Zed-Grade Putty

Ah well, we also unlock the Marketing mechanic for the Studio and are left with a very critical decision to make. That said, the boss monster for this episode is very, very annoying for those seeking to complete every Director's Instruction in the game. His unique attack gives him exceptional mobility, and having a -1 movement actor hampers me from finishing the episode as quickly as I could have if I had ignored the Director Instruction. This isn't the last time in the game that this can prove to be problematic, but Season 1 leaves us very bare bones in terms of countering the mechanic via Skills. Eagle Lasso is the key to get that Finishing Move on my run this time thanks to the AI used by the boss monster, but it doesn't always wind up that way. All depends on where Barrel Man ends up after a roll or if he chooses to perform some basic attacks instead. Thread Vote Opportunity! Voting will last until 11:59 PM Sunday. pre:New Baddies Breakdown Code Name: Weak Breadcrumbler Secret Identity: Comicon Falco Cosplayers Type: Grunt Life: 90 HP Attacks: Pistol - 26-33 damage Bomb Toss - AoE Damage skill, roughly as damaging as their Pistol. Increased chance of inflicting Knockback Counter Rate: 4% Dodge Rate: 12% Threat Level: Putty. (Frustrating beyond their threat level at times, however.) Code Name: Barrel Man Secret Identity: Reject from Pirates of the Caribbean Type: Boss Life: 480 HP Attacks: Punch - 31-35 damage Rollout - Barrel Man rolls through a long line of squares, dealing damage equal to his basic Punch along the way to every entity he rolls over. Makes him highly maneuverable. Can Knockback. Counter Rate: 0% Dodge Rate: 0% Threat Level: Gnarly Gnome Ronin Of Dreams fucked around with this message at 06:14 on May 25, 2017 |
